Greta Isaac has announced her ‘Dolly Zoom’ EP, and shared new single ‘Soft Scoop Talking Dog’

Greta Isaac has announced her new EP ‘Dolly Zoom’, set for release on 8th August via Kartel Music Group. The Welsh-born, London-based artist has also shared the project’s first single, ‘Soft Scoop Talking Dog’.

The EP introduces Isaac’s alter ego Dolly Zoom, blending early 2000s electronic pop with rock elements. The character of Dolly represents what Isaac and visual collaborator Karina Barberis describe as “a character of extremes. She is the mania that runs beneath a rationalised exterior; the vision you might have of screaming at someone you smile politely to instead, the thought you have of jumping off a high building but never doing it, the disturbed, hyper, playful, imaginative parts of us we subdue. Dolly Zoom is a character born out of restriction and ordinariness, a means of unleashing the messy parts of us that society wants us to conform to”.

‘Soft Scoop Talking Dog’, written alongside Martin Luke Brown, Mark Elliot, and Matt Zara, was produced by Zara and Dan Bartlett. The track comes accompanied by a visualiser featuring Welsh translated lyrics.

Speaking about the single, Isaac says: “Soft Scoop Talking Dog is our janky, explosive introduction to Dolly – born from the feeling of being trapped within a claustrophobic room of how we think we should look or behave or speak. Dolly kicks that door down, emerges from the chaos outside, grabs you by the hand and grins at you through a seductive haze of (vape) smoke and promises, she whispers, ‘come with me, it doesn’t have to be this way’.”
